2009-07-01 2 views
38

Я хочу выяснить, когда службы запускались и заканчивались. Есть ли какой-либо файл журнала?Есть ли файл журнала о статусе служб Windows?

+1

может быть связано с программированием, если OP необходимо добавить код в службу, чтобы включить ведение журнала. – CoderDennis

+0

или может быть его собственный сервис :) –

ответ

35

Посмотрите на журнал System в Windows EventViewer (eventvwr из командной строки).
Вы должны увидеть записи с источником как «Service Control Manager». например на моей машине WinXP,

Event Type: Information 
Event Source: Service Control Manager 
Event Category: None 
Event ID: 7036 
Date:  7/1/2009 
Time:  12:09:43 PM 
User:  N/A 
Computer: MyMachine 
Description: 
The Background Intelligent Transfer Service service entered the running state. 

For more information, see Help and Support Center at http://go.microsoft.com/fwlink/events.asp. 
+4

Если бы он также показывал источник команды SC. ☹ – Synetech

3

Наиболее вероятное место, чтобы найти такого рода информации в окне просмотра событий (по административным инструментам в XP или запустить eventvwr) Это где большинство услуг войти предупреждения ошибок и т.д.

4

С помощью консоли управления компьютером перейдите по средствам просмотра событий> Журналы Windows> Система. Здесь будут регистрироваться все службы, которые меняют состояние.

Вы увидите, как информация: Служба XXXX перешла в состояние Работает или Служба XXXX введенную остановленное состояние и т.д.

37

В операционной системе Windows 7, откройте окно просмотра событий. Вы можете сделать это путь Gishu предложенный для XP, набрав eventvwr из командной строки, либо открыв Панель управления, выбрав Система и безопасность, затем Администрирование и, наконец просмотра событий. Это может потребовать одобрение UAC или пароль администратора.

В левой панели разверните Журналы Windows и затем System. Вы можете отфильтровать журналы с помощью Фильтровать текущий журнал ... с панели «Действия» справа и выбрав «Диспетчер управления сервисом». Или, в зависимости от того, зачем вам нужна эта информация, вам просто нужно просмотреть записи Ошибки.

enter image description here

Фактическая запись в журнале панели (не показан), довольно удобно и понятно. Вы будете искать такие сообщения, как:

«Служба Praxco Assistant вошла в состояние остановки».
«Служба Windows Image Acquisition (WIA) вошла в рабочее состояние».
«Служба MySQL прекратилась неожиданно, она сделала это 3 раза».

+1

как вы поднимаете многословие или лог-уровень? текущая многословность этих сообщений - шутка. – n611x007

+0

В разделе «Уровень события» вы должны выбрать «Критический» для получения дополнительной информации или любых других опций для получения дополнительной информации. Ваша догадка так же хороша, как и моя, почему они заказывали их вверх-вниз перед левым и правым. – Pops